Formula & worked example
stored bytes/day = Σ(events/s × bytes/event) × active seconds × ratio × copies
500 × 800-byte and 100 × 1,200-byte events each second, active all day
- Inputs
- (500 × 800 + 100 × 1,200) × 86,400 = 44.928 GB/day
- Calculation
- 44.928 GB/day × 30 days × 100% × 1 copy
The default steady-rate plan requires 1.34784 TB for 30 days.
